  1. Cheryl Lynn Holdridge (née Phelps; June 20, 1944 – January 6, 2009) was an American actress, best known as an original cast member of The Mickey Mouse Club.

  2. Cheryl Holdridge (1944-2009) was an actress, known for Leave It to Beaver, The Donna Reed Show and Life with Archie. She was also a former Mouseketeer on The Mickey Mouse Club and sang "Land of Me Oh My".
